Description

1 Ducat from Austrian Empire. Issued from 1781 to 1786. Struck in Gold (.986). Measures 0 mm and weighs 3.5 g.

Obverse
Laureate portrait in armour facing right, mint mark below bust, legend around (starts 1h).
Reverse
Crowned double headed imperial eagle with Habsburg Lorraine arms, legend around (starts 1h).
